#389270 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#389270 is composed of 22% red, 57.3% green and 43.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 23.3% yellow and 42.7% black. It has a hue angle of 157.3 degrees, a saturation of 44.6% and a lightness of 39.6%. #389270 color hex could be obtained by blending #70ffe0 with #002500.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

#389270 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#389270 has RGB values of R:56, G:146, B:112 and CMYK values of C:0.62, M:0, Y:0.23, K:0.43. Its decimal value is 3707504.

Shades and Tints of #389270
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020403 is the darkest color, while #f5fbf9 is the lightest one.
